Why Embracing Chaos Matters
Modern life constantly demands our best, but creative work doesn't always follow a straight line. If you've ever felt frustrated because your creative energy seemed to evaporate just as you sat down to work, you're not alone.
We're often told that consistency is key, yet creativity thrives on inspiration, which can be interrupted by everything from bad weather to noisy neighbors.

A New Way to Think About Productivity
Megan offers a refreshing take: productivity doesn't have to be rigid. Instead, it can flow with your mood. Picture those days when everything seems out of sync.
By aligning your tasks with your emotional atmosphere, you can create more naturally and effectively.
